Tatamy Posted February 22 Share Posted February 22 19 minutes ago, LVLion77 said: I do not think it is unreasonable to be highly skeptical of the NWS forecast for the Lehigh Valley. 10-20” is wishcasting. 4-8” is much more reasonable in my opinion. They’re in a tough spot as the models have been all over the place. They use the NBM which is a weighted model containing most all of the other models outputs ( It’s like a mean of the other model projections). Because of how it works there is a delay in terms of it not recognizing the newest data. Incidentally your number seems reasonable to me.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
